A range of laboratory tests of rocks – the non-accredited section
- Determination of rock moisture content – Methodologies of ČGÚ 1987
- Determination of absorption capacity of rock – Methodologies of ČGÚ 1987, ČSN EN 13755, ČSN EN 13383-2
- Determination of density of solid particles of rock – (in the Laboratories of Soil Mechanics according to ČSN CEN ISO/TS 17892-3)
- Determination of rock porosity – Methodologies of ČGÚ 1987, ČSN EN 1936
- Determination of bulk density of rock – Methodologies of ČGÚ 1987, ČSN EN 1936, ČSN EN 13383-2
- Determination of uniaxial (unconfined) compressive strength – ČSN EN 1926
- Determination of compressive strength by crushing irregular specimens – Methodologies of ČGÚ 1987, methodologies of GEOtest
- Determination of point load strength index – Methodologies of ČGÚ 1987
- Determination of transverse tensile strength – Methodologies of ČGÚ 1987
- Determination of unconfined shear strength by a circular die (punch) – Methodologies of ČGÚ 1987
- Determination of compressive strength by coaxial dies (punches) – Rock Mechanics, ČVUT (Czech Technical University) Praha 1967
- Determination of strength under bending – at constant momentum – ČSN EN 13161
- Determination of strength under bending – in concentric loading – ČSN EN 12372
- Determination of tensile strength under bending according to Ruppenjat – Rock Mechanics, ČVUT Praha 1967
- Determination of shear strength in combination with compression by a test on irregular specimens – Methodologies of ČGÚ 1987
- Evaluation of shear strength parameters according to Mohr-Coulomb – Methodologies of GEOtest
- Determination of deformation properties in unconfined compression – Methodologies of ČGÚ 1987, ČSN EN 14580
- Determination of frost resistance – ČSN EN 12371, ČSN EN 13383-2
- Box shear test of coarse-grained materials (a box 500 x 500 x 300 mm) – Methodologies of GEOtest
- Oedometer test of coarse-grained materials (an oedometer of 500 mm in diameter and 500 mm in height) – Methodologies of GEOtest
Laboratory tests are carried out on rock samples prepared by cutting from drill core or from boulder samples (on cylinders or cubes), or on smaller rock fragments. Tests of bulk density, strength and deformation characteristics are performed in the dry or saturated state, or with moisture content in the state delivered by a client.
Based on the results of strength tests, classification of rock is performed according to ČSN 73 6133, including a brief description according to ČSN EN ISO 14689-1. The results are presented in the form of a protocol of tests, including a brief description of the methodology of their making.
